To succeed in business today, one needs to be flexible and have good planning and organizational skills. Many people start a business thinking that they'll power on their computers or open their doors and start making money, only to find that making money in a business is much more difficult than they thought. You can avoid this in your business ventures by taking your time and planning out all the necessary steps you need to achieve success.

Some companies are just better than others. It could be name recognition, innovation, market share or any other number of other attributes that make a good company stand out from the crowd.  So, what is it about a company that makes a successful company, and does that description equate to a good stock to invest in? The answer depends on whether you ask an accountant, an economist, a marketer or a human resources expert, but by pulling all of those disciplines together, you generally can define a successful company.

If the company has a competitive advantage, above-average management and market leadership, you are looking at a potentially strong option for your investment. While these traits alone don't necessarily tell the whole story, they are important factors in evaluating whether a company might be recognized by investors globally as a good investment.

How then do you cultivate your success?

Feeling like you are treading the waters with your business and you are not making progress towards your goals on being successful? Here are some take away on how to make it happen, and remember; building a successful business is a marathon and not a sprint. Just like the old say goes:  "Rome was not built in a day."

You won’t find one formula explaining to you what makes a company successful. But successful companies tend to focus on the same things, even if the approach is different.  Customer service experience:  the current market customer journey has extra procedures than before, meaning that to stay unique, you've got to constantly prove your worth throughout the process with technology at the center of innovation. Even some of the small steps companies take, like a few extra benefits they offer employees, contribute to their success. It takes a long time to build your company, and longer to create the kind of long-term success you’re looking for.

Here are a few strategies you need to do:

Why do you exist? pursuing a mission

Discovering why you exist as a company is essential to running all aspects of the business. It helps the founders grow the company with a major goal in mind. It gives the employees something to work towards, and creates a sense of purpose. It also lets customers know what the company stands for and helps give them a personal connection.

Your mission is more than just a banner declaring that you stand for something. Your business should run according to the mission. Do you say you’re devoted to using clean energy? Then you should invest in clean energy for your facilities, and find vendors and suppliers at all points of your supply chain who also invest in or use clean energy. The more your mission can focus how your business runs, the more meaning it’ll add to your company.

Focusing on customer experience

Customer service and customer experience are a major focus of the most successful businesses. The first step is creating products and services that full-fill your customers' needs, they need to know that your business understands them, their interests and how they process information. But focusing on customers goes beyond your products. Customers are tired of dealing with companies through phone menus and automated chat bots. They want a human connection. For a customer, it’s important to feel like their problem is valued, and that you’ll work to solve their problems.

Just a few bad customer experiences can have a big impact on how well-liked a business is. People will return to your brand because of exemplary customer service, even if you don’t have the lowest price. Customers don’t want to fight with dissatisfied employees to prove that their problem is worth a company’s time. Even if you start small, provide good customer service and you’ll keep people coming back.

Finding and keeping the right team

Excellent managers are part of how a successful company keeps good and the right employees on payroll. A mission with great core values that employees can believe in is another way. The most successful companies recognize the good talent they have, and work to keep it. That means more than a competitive salary and a few benefits. Employees need to fit in with the company culture and feel valued for their contributions. That way you don’t lose someone to a similar position at another company.

"Employees do not leave companies, they leave managers."

Cut your business costs

New technology gives businesses the chance to lower costs and also to improve the customer experience. Automating a system or using software to analyze customer data will enhance how the company runs. The best companies are always adapting to new technology and making it work for them. Even if you can’t afford something big and fancy, look into new software or office equipment that will make your days easier.

Brand experience

In order to create a positive connotations for your brand, positive experiences are a must and just as your choice of brand colors has an impactful meaning for your brand, typography is equally as powerful in representing the values and tone of your brand and creates a different representation of who you are and what you stand for as a brand.

Every business has a unique approach to these elements of success. One business may get more mileage out of investing in new technology, while another might find that increasing quality customer service is the best way to go. If you want to emulate successful businesses, always keep learning. Follow your favorite business leaders and track the companies you admire. You’ll continue to get ideas for giving your own business more success if you learn from both their triumphs and failures.